Cholangiocarcinoma & Hepatocellular Carcinoma Latest Progress in Management

Significant strides are being made in the therapy of liver-biliary malignancies . Immunotherapy , particularly those targeting PD-1 , are now available for specific patients with unresectable h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C). Furthermore, drugs targeting specific mutations focusing on molecular alterations are showing efficacy in studies . Minimally invasive surgical approaches are improving outcomes for resectable tumors, and liver-directed therapies like Y-90 are providing benefit for patients with initially unresectable . Finally, ongoing research is exploring novel combinations and preventative strategies to improve survival rates and quality of life .

Exploring Hepatobiliary Malignancy Potential Factors

Understanding the multifaceted landscape of liver-biliary cancer risk elements is crucial for prevention and prompt diagnosis . Several controllable hepatobiliary neoplasm elements notably increase the probability of contracting this severe condition. These include long-standing liver inflammation , such as hep B and HCV , alongside excessive alcohol intake and non-alcoholic hepatic disorder . Furthermore, exposure to certain environmental chemicals and a inherited predisposition of hepatobiliary tumor are linked with amplified danger .
